### Solver returns empty timetable

If the Gradewise solver responds with an empty schedule but status 200, the constraint cache is usually stale. Flush it via the admin endpoint, then rerun the solve for the affected term. The flush call requires elevated access; authenticate the request with the bearer token below.

login token, hahif-bajog: eyJhbGciOiJIUzI1NiIsInR5cCI6IkpXVCJ9.eyJzdWIiOiIHJXUrbIn0.JC-NFEAJ

## Calendar Sync Conflicts — Who to Contact

If Tideway Calendar shows duplicate or phantom events after syncing with Plover Scheduler, it's usually a timezone offset bug in the sync bridge, owned by the Meridian Integrations team. First check the sync status page and retry once; most conflicts self-heal within an hour. Persistent duplicates or dropped invites should be reported with the event ID and both calendar views attached. For anything affecting exec calendars, skip triage and escalate directly via the address below.

alerts address for bajop-yahog: istwyn@lumiclabs.internal

Subject: Reset flow revamp — action needed

Team,

Quick summary for anyone onboarding: the Tallowmere reset flow now issues single-use links valid for 10 minutes, replacing the old 24-hour window. Your integration must stop caching reset URLs. Sandbox is live; production cutover is next sprint. Docs are on the Brindlegate portal. For sandbox testing, authenticate requests with the token below.

session JWT of yawep-yawep = eyJhbGciOiJIUzI1NiIsInR5cCI6IkpXVCJ9.eyJzdWIiOiI3pWF3_In0.aXYsHiog